Debug feature within Task Manager
Hi all,
I would like to know how to activate the debug feature within the Task Manager? If you right-click on the Taskbar at the bottom of your screen and select Task Manager, go under the Processes tab and right-click on any process, you get the "Debug" feature. I have several PCs that have this option active while others have it greyed out. What must I do to have this option available? Ercle. |

Re: Debug feature within Task Manager
Perhaps you need the "Debugging Tools for Windows" installed.

Re: Debug feature within Task Manager
You also have to open a command window and navigate to the "c:\program
files\debugging tools for window" folder and type "windbg /I" without quotes. (And the "I" must be capitalized.)
